site stats

Getinitialprops nextjs typescript

WebApr 19, 2024 · You can also type getInitialProps using the NextPageContext type. import { NextPage, NextPageContext } from 'next'; const MyComponent: … WebTypeScript You can use the built-in DocumentContext type and change the file name to ./pages/_document.tsx like so: import Document , { DocumentContext , …

Pass prop to every single page in Next.js with getInitialProps …

WebMay 31, 2024 · import type { NextPageWithLayout } from 'next'; const ExamplePage: NextPageWithLayout = => { // snip } // If you won't define … { (props: … teresa ribera bruselas https://deardiarystationery.com

Next.js: подробное руководство. Итерация первая / Хабр

WebNov 6, 2024 · I believe you need types that will be caught up by getInitialProps as well. There they are: type Props = AppProps & P; interface AppType Web有些事情发生在babel身上,它无法编译我的故事书代码我正试着用故事书和下一本书组装一个样板我做了一次搜索,找不到解决这个问题的办法,如果有人能帮忙的话,我会很感激的。这是我在尝试构建时遇到的错... WebDec 24, 2024 · It uses react-intl for translations and was written in TypeScript. In the previous version I had a custom server.js and handled sub-routing (/de, /fr, etc.) for multilingual purposes in it. And in custom app component, through the getInitialProps, I was getting locale from req and passed it as a prop to my component. teresa ribera cv

Data Fetching: getServerSideProps Next.js

Category:javascript - Typescript with NextJS - Stack Overflow

Tags:Getinitialprops nextjs typescript

Getinitialprops nextjs typescript

Nextjs, react and TypeScript: prop type missing on FC using ...

Webreactjs 为什么console.log在我点击按钮后第二次打印状态,即使状态的值没有改变?

Getinitialprops nextjs typescript

Did you know?

WebJun 30, 2024 · Since the navigation needs to be available on every page, I added getInitialProps to the _app.js file, which grabs the left nav and passes it to the left nav component. But now as I'm moving on to build the homepage, I see that the getInitialProps there does not run. It seems that the getInitialProps in _app.js takes precendence. WebOpen package.json and add the following scripts: "scripts": { "dev": "next dev", "build": "next build", "start": "next start", "lint": "next lint" } These scripts refer to the different stages of …

WebJul 25, 2024 · It creates new types NextLayoutComponentType and AppLayoutProps that we can use in place of original types. Our initial code will need to be changed to this: // pages/_app.tsx import { AppContext, AppInitialProps, AppLayoutProps } from 'next/app'; import type { NextComponentType } from 'next'; import { ReactNode } from 'react'; const … WebMay 29, 2024 · Typescript with NextJS. I've been struggling to integrate Typescript with NextJS, mainly with destructured parameters in getInitialProps but also with the type of …

WebApr 7, 2024 · Teams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ams WebFeb 24, 2024 · 1 Answer. According to nextJS documentation the put it as a optional props. interface Props { userAgent?: string; } const Page: NextPage = ( { userAgent }) …

WebFeb 25, 2024 · Did some Googling and saw some say use Next's router (but didn't see that return the domain), other using getInitialProps but didn't see how to incorporate into a functional component. New to all of this, so just trying to find the best way, seems like it should be simple.

WebAdd TypeScript type to Next.js getInitialProps Solution #1: Define your getInitialProps type. Solution #2: Use NextPageContext. In the example above, I’ve defined ctx as any. … teresa ribera spainWebJan 6, 2024 · You need to run the respective Component 's getInitialProps each time, and not the App 's. Change your _app.js following line: if (Component.getInitialProps) pageProps = await App.getInitialProps (ctx); to if (Component.getInitialProps) pageProps = await Component.getInitialProps (ctx); I hope this solves your issue. Share Improve … teresa ribera ministraWebIf you're using getInitialProps, you can follow the directions on this page. API Routes The following is an example of how to use the built-in types for API routes: import type { … teresa ribera mar menor